Consent Banner Rollout — Step 3 (Varkel Regions)

Once the Tindale flag service confirms the banner variant, push the config to the Quorast edge nodes. Verify the opt-out event reaches the Pellwick consent ledger within two minutes. If events stall, restart the ledger ingest worker before escalating to the on-call. To run the verification script, authenticate against the ledger service using the key below.

service key, fawip-bajef: kto11_Qt5wZK9vdNC

**Vendor note: Inkmill markdown pipeline**

Rendering for Parchway docs is outsourced to Inkmill under an annual contract, renewing each March. They handle sanitization and PDF export; we own the upload queue. SLA: 4-hour response on rendering failures. Escalate only after two failed retries. Their support desk is reachable at the address below.

billing contact of hahaf-baguf = zorael.tammir.jorius@sivrelhq.internal

Subject: Validator plugin cut-over — done!

Hey all, quick recap for the sync: we flipped Brambleworks over to the new plugin system for data validators on Tuesday. All legacy checks now run as plugins, and the old hardcoded chain is gone. Zero regressions so far. Here are the config values now in effect:

config for yajep-tafof:
[rusath]
team = julmir
access_code = ac_fe37fd
host = rusath.novactech.test
port = 8000
owner = pelmir.weneth
peer = oliwyn.olvarqdyn.internal

LEADERSHIP REVIEW BRIEFING — Regional Sales

For sales leads: the Tannerford region exceeded targets by 6%, while Greyhaven lagged owing to delayed Calyx Pro shipments. Renata Vosk will present corrective staffing proposals at Thursday's review. Please verify your pipeline figures beforehand, as leadership will probe assumptions closely. The confidential note on forward plans is set out immediately below.

internal memo for hafog-hadug: The pricing group signed off on a budget of $16.1 million for Project Gorir. The renewal with Oliionax Systems closes at $14.1 million a year, 46 percent above the last contract.